Om and Its Meaning in Buddhism

Buddhism is another religion within which the Om symbol plays an important role. Now, the earlier forms of Buddhism did not have much to do with the Om symbol, but this did change over time.

This is especially true with Tibetan Buddhism, which was greatly influenced by Hinduism.

The Om symbol is often placed at the beginning and/or end of Buddhist mantras and texts. One of the most commonly known mantras is Om mani padme hum, the mantra of compassion. Many people interpret this mantra as the “totality of sound, existence, and consciousness.”

During the 14th century, the Dalai Lama described Om as consisting of 3 separate letters, these being A, U, and M. There are various symbolizations associated with these 3 letters including the “pure exalted body, speech, and mind of the enlightened Buddha.
The Om also symbolizes “wholeness, perfection, and the infinite.” On many statues and Eastern Asian monuments, the Buddhist Om is featured by a pair of fierce guardian kings, one which pronounces the A part while the other pronounces the UM. Together, these kings are considered to be saying “the absolute.”
